Railroad Earth is an American jam band born in Stillwater, New Jersey, renowned for weaving together bluegrass, folk, jazz, and rock into a rich, soulful tapestry that defies easy categorization. Formed in 2001, the band built its reputation through passionate live performances and an improvisational spirit that has earned them a deeply devoted following across the country.
Led by vocalist and multi-instrumentalist Todd Sheaffer, Railroad Earth crafts music that feels both rooted in American tradition and gloriously free-spirited. Their acoustic-driven sound — laced with fiddle, banjo, mandolin, and upright bass — carries the warmth of a campfire and the energy of a festival stage. Albums like *Bird in a House* and *Amen Corner* showcase their ability to blend introspective songwriting with explosive musical adventures.
